Core Insights - Xiaomi's new car, YU7, achieved an impressive sales milestone of 200,000 pre-orders in just 3 minutes, prompting competitors to enter "war mode" [1] - Li Auto has made significant organizational changes, with President Ma Donghui now overseeing research, supply manufacturing, and sales, reporting directly to CEO Li Xiang [1][2] - The restructuring aims to enhance collaboration between production, supply chain, and sales, supporting a strategic to operational closed loop [1] Company Developments - Li Auto's sales and service senior vice president Zou Liangjun will continue as a sales service advisor, while the head of the overseas department has changed from Wang Jin to Wu Zuomin, who has experience in overseas markets [2] - CEO Li Xiang remains focused on product lines, branding, and strategy, with an increased emphasis on artificial intelligence, particularly in the area of advanced driver assistance systems [2] Market Competition - The personnel changes at Li Auto are strategically timed ahead of the launch of two new electric models, positioning the company against competitors like Tesla's Model Y and Xiaomi's YU7 [3] - Li Auto plans to lower its second-quarter sales target, having delivered 92,800 vehicles in the first quarter and initially aiming for 123,000 to 128,000 in the second quarter [3] - The company is consolidating its sales regions from 26 to five major areas to better allocate resources amid increasing competition in both range-extended and pure electric vehicle segments [3] - Li Auto has established over 2,500 fast-charging stations and aims to reach 4,000 by the end of the year, adding an average of four stations daily [3]
